Troubleshooting and Common Issues

1. Cylinder Leakage: Check for damaged seals or loose connections. Replace seals and tighten connections as needed.

2. Cylinder Slow Operation: Inspect the hydraulic fluid levels and ensure they meet the manufacturer’s recommendations. Check for any restrictions in the hydraulic lines.

3. Cylinder Overheating: Verify that the hydraulic fluid is at the correct temperature and replace any faulty cooling components.

Sealing and Lubrication

For optimal performance, hydraulic cylinders utilize various seals, including piston seals and rod seals. These seals are made from wear-resistant materials like polyurethane or nitrile rubber. Additionally, the cylinder body and threaded ends undergo precise surface treatments to enhance wear resistance. Regular lubrication with the appropriate hydraulic oil is crucial to ensure smooth operation and reduce friction.
